BPR Website: Always a Work in Progress

Corey Rowland – June 6, 2017

A website is a crucial tool for any business or organization that seeks success. And who doesn’t want that? It’s also something that evolves.

Bobcat Promotions had a website that was clean and well organized, but it needed a little updating to match changes within the student-run PR firm. The website — www.bobcatpromotions.com — would mostly serve as a source of pride for staff members and a 24/7 face for prospective clients.

BPR’s first digital team — Andrew Wallace-Bradley, Krystyna Castro and Danielle Martinez — was created to determine how to redesign and reorganize the website in a way that was interesting, informative and inviting to various target audiences.

Faculty adviser Chuck Kaufman acknowledged that all three students brought “senior leadership and a very full toolbox” to the project. “They also had different insights as to what could be accomplished and how to execute their plans,” he added, “so that is a very healthy situation for the creative process.”

The team felt the former site was outdated visually and could do a better job of telling the mass media firm’s story with its very deep bench of talent from various disciplines reflecting our various majors, particularly PR, Advertising, Electronic Media and DMI.

There were many goals that were set for the new website. First, the should reflect issues that the firm faces in addressing the needs of its clients,” said Martinez, a veteran who will lead the media organization through the summer and next fall. Thus, BPR could connect its expertise with real, day-to-day activity. Bobcat Promotions has a strong digital focus for its clients, whether it’s developing websites or managing social media platforms.

Another goal for the website was to be more modern, informative and visually appealing. The reasoning behind this is to help the traffic of students and clients continue to come back to the site again and again and to help expand BPR’s brand.

New Website Homepage

Considering the target audience for the website is for students, current clients and future clients, the main purpose of the site is reflect how BPR is current with industry and professional practices and trends.

The new site, like the former site, takes advantage of the backoffice and themes of WordPress sites. The new site has a different theme and overall structure. The home page features sliding photos and tabs that clearly define the firm’s clients and capabilities.

“The improvements of our site should be a great source of pride to our staff and appealing to prospective clients,” Martinez said. “Everyone on the team has a true passion for what they do and hopefully the website will showcase to students and clients how much the team truly cares and will continue to help the organization grow internally and externally.”
